From 8dcf0d95b654fa6cc56193168aaa744052ad8ffc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Richard Purdie Date: Tue, 20 Aug 2013 21:14:02 +0000 Subject: gcc-package-sdk.inc: Allow executable extension to be overridden On platforms like windows, executables have extensions. Whilst I'm not proposing we wholesale support windows extensions, this small tweak allows a cross compiler targetting mingw to be built which does seem like a good use case. The patch therefore adds an EXEEXT which the mingw layer can set for the libexec symlinks.
